This volatile oil, celebrated for its powerful antiseptic and anti-inflammatory properties, offers a sophisticated approach to addressing the root causes of scalp issues rather than merely treating surface symptoms. Tea tree oil, a concentrated essence derived from the leaves of the *Melaleuca alternifolia* plant, has established itself as a cornerstone ingredient in premium cleansing and conditioning formulations.
When integrated into a shampoo and conditioner duo, it creates a synergistic system designed to cleanse the hair at a molecular level while simultaneously soothing the scalp environment.
